Gardening

I have been busy lately tending my garden. Spring is here and it's time to start digging and planting for summer crops. I was so happy to see my compost looking pretty good and it will be ready in 2 weeks. I decided to try making my own compost because I spend so much money buying garden soil. Every year the price is getting higher. So this year, I we only got those soil amender, for the clay soil we have in the side of our house where it gets more sun. So I was trying to mix some soil to make it better for my vegetables. Last year, we had a very good result with our tomatoes and egg plant but this year I plan to plant more okra and beans and hoping we get good plants this year. We will also try to plant some cauliflower and broccoli. I am not too excited about this because I read that it is a little hard to grow those but we will try. We did corn last year and got some but they did not grow as much as I want them to. I learned that they really need a lot of sun. Hopefully, this year will be better and yield more vegetables.
